Transaction 3880bfaa9377c4a884fc35ba765965f6b67ede18042f34000bbdc4c4b8343263

17 Input
2 Outputs
  • 3880bfaa9377c4a884fc35ba765965f6b67ede18042f34000bbdc4c4b8343263:0
  • value  3200216906
    address  37BvgetP2ddy6RKiBqCYFwUsLvLRWxxKS4
  • 3880bfaa9377c4a884fc35ba765965f6b67ede18042f34000bbdc4c4b8343263:1
  • value  65179007
    address  35vChDjQVoDSar5mhuy25nyKvUaBxQD1s9